Output 75c801eb08044b185524621e4e041e763d459c67982359e79f91562e2c62153a:2

value
5444944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aeda25fffd29adfb1eb729dbe964851481da51e OP_EQUAL
address
39yoQvkVrKr7v9NzbyPeCfY9vNrcsNeR5S
transaction
75c801eb08044b185524621e4e041e763d459c67982359e79f91562e2c62153a
spent
true